Output 89e13b31c945065395cd1060b78823df004fb78cfade5627a2d354ba05b76997:0

value
143635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 591c247eb4cd11c47f8da2ef704e38927696a13f OP_EQUAL
address
39pBmziTGKSrtXUH4jAz9W4h8pQ3m1XrRY
transaction
89e13b31c945065395cd1060b78823df004fb78cfade5627a2d354ba05b76997